Moreno Glacier is a famous glacier located in Los Glaciares National Park in Argentina. It is one of the most visited tourist attractions in Argentina and is known for its breathtaking beauty and size. The glacier is approximately 30 km long and 5 km wide, with a height of up to 60 meters above the lake level. It is a part of the Southern Patagonian Ice Field, which is the third-largest reserve of freshwater in the world. The glacier is unique because it is constantly advancing, unlike most glaciers which are receding due to climate change. It moves at a rate of about 2 meters per day, which causes ice to break off and fall into the lake below with a thunderous sound. The glacier is surrounded by pristine forests, mountains, and lakes, making it a perfect destination for nature lovers. Visitors can take boat tours or hike along the trails to get a closer look at the glacier. The Los Glaciares National Park, where Moreno Glacier is located, was declared a UNESCO World Heritage Site in 1981. It is home to many other glaciers, lakes, and mountain ranges, making it a must-visit destination for anyone visiting Argentina.
